Aircraft Maintenance
We operate out of Hangar H at Grand Central Airport in Johannesburg, and we have the resources to hangar and maintain a number of different aircraft. Our approved maintenance organization offers maintenance services on Pratt and Whitney PT6 (small and large) engines and the full range of Lycoming and Continental engines. The AMO also covers the following airframes:

  • Cessna 100, 200 and 400 series (incl. Reims 406)
  • Piper 28, 31,32, 34, 36
  • Partenavia P68 series

Spectrometers
We are an authorised reseller of SPECTRAL EVOLUTION spectrometers, spectroradiometers and spectrophotometers. These state-of-the-art UV-VIS-NIR-SWIR full-range instruments are used to measure electromagnetic energy, spectral radiance and irradiance as well as capture and evaluate colour. Users receive qualitative analysis results, usually in the form of wavelength data.

Spectrometers, spectroradiometers and spectrophotometers can be laboratory based or handheld and portable. They can be used for a wide range of qualitative applications that range from vegetation, crops, soil and agriculture to water, snow, ice and atmospheric and climate studies. Additional uses are for pharmaceuticals, food identification, consumer-related applications, geology and mining exploration.

The instruments can be equipped with various accessories to provide the user with a system suited exactly to their needs. Accessories include backpacks for field use, leaf clips, contact probes, field of view lenses, reflectance panels and much more.
